LABOR FORCE WAGES

In June 2012, the Kane County unemployment rate was 9.2% and the Chicago Metro was 8.6%. More detailed labor force data is available on the Illinois Department of Employment Security, Labor Market Information website, lmi.ides.state.il.us.

2011 Wage Rates for Kane County, IL
Labor Wages
Entry
Median
Accountant/Auditor $24.09 $43.05
Assembler - Electronic $9.56 $12.32
Assembler - Production $9.45 $11.93
Computer Operator $11.60 $17.86
Computer Programmer $21.27 $39.12
Data Entry Operator $10.68 $13.42
Drill or Punch Press $14.33 $20.63
Engineer $35.76 $46.92
Janitor/Porter/Cleaner $9.54 $11.85
Laborer $8.51 $9.53
Machinist $12.04 $18.40
Maintenance/Mechanic $20.22 $23.20
Office Clerk $10.51 $14.27
Sheet Metal Worker $26.69 $33.36
Shipping/Receiving Clerk $10.72 $13.75
Systems Analyst $36.47 $45.31
Technician $17.18 $29.56
Tool & Die Maker $19.01 $24.20
Word Processor $12.92 $14.47

Excerpt: http://lmi.ides.state.il..us/wagedata/wage.htm

LARGEST GENEVA EMPLOYERS
Company Name Product/Service
Employees
Delnor-Community Hospital Hospital/medical offices
1693
Kane County County Government
1350
Geneva School District #304 School District
640
Kane County Cougars Class A baseball team
880
Burgess Norton, div. of Amsted Ind. Piston Pins, Powder Metal
389
Johnson Controls Battery Group Mfg automotive batteries
300
Peacock Engineering Co Inc Pkg and co-mfg facility
250
City of Geneva City Government FTE
187
Millard Refrigerated Services Refrigerated warehousing
220
Exel North American Logistics Wholesale general groceries
200
Houghton Mifflin Co Publisher
200
Little Traveler Inc Retailer/restaurant
169
Nicor Service Gas distribution company
158
Home Depot USA Inc Home improvement store
147
FONA International Inc R & D flavoring extracts
136
Miner Enterprises Inc Design & mfg railcar elements
130
Gordon Flesch Co Inc Business equip. solutions
121
Provena Health Inc Medical care services
115
Industrial Hard Chrome Ltd Electroplating service
110
KCA Financial Services Inc Collection agency
105
Best Buy Electronics and media store
105
Continental Envelope Envelope printing
105
Carlton Home Healthcare Inc Home Health care services
100
Herrington Inn Inc. Hotel, banquet, spa facility
92
Eaglebrook Country Club Country Club - golf & rec
80
